This role involves conducting control testing, assessing operational risks, and reporting on findings within CIBC's Technology Infrastructure and Innovation (TI&I) business. The specialist will collaborate with various teams to design and implement robust control frameworks, 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, and support strategic initiatives by identifying and addressing control gaps, leveraging data analytics and emerging technologies.
Conduct control testing, providing assessment, consulting, and reporting on operational risk and controls.,Understand and follow qualitative and quantitative components of Risk Appetite Statements.,Escalate matters through appropriate channels.,Collaborate with team members, stakeholders, and partners on control design and operating effectiveness testing.,Assess the control environment to ensure controls are complete, thorough, meet regulatory requirements, match industry standards, and align to CIBC’s policies and standards.,Implement control frameworks and practices that address evolving regulatory and compliance requirements.,Partner with TI&I teams to ensure alignment and currency of controls.,Manage risk and meet industry and regulatory standards.,Analyze processes and requirements, provide clear advice.,Plan projects, keep stakeholders updated on progress, and communicate realistic timelines.,Identify ways to improve and automate processes using technology.,Work with various teams including risk, compliance, and audit for a united approach.,Support internal clients by understanding their needs and offering advice on risk and technology solutions.,Communicate clearly through reports and presentations.,Build strong working relationships across all teams.,Stay up to date on new trends and best practices in operations and controls.,Deliver results by using technology insights to find control gaps and aid decision-making.
Degree/diploma in accounting, finance, business, or a related field.,2–5 years of experience in front-line testing, audit, enterprise or operational risk management, or management consulting.,One or more professional certifications relevant to operational control testing.,Hands-on experience conducting or managing internal and external audits, with a strong understanding of audit methodologies and standards.,Adept at designing and executing control testing plans (walkthroughs, sampling, substantive testing) using both manual and automated techniques.,Ability to work independently and effectively within cross-functional teams, influencing stakeholders at all levels.,Skilled in creating process flows that clearly represent current and future states.,Strong understanding of risk management and control testing.,Experience implementing or supporting RPA and AI solutions within audit, compliance, or control testing environments.,Advocates for the adoption of digital tools and fosters a culture of continuous improvement.,Leverages data analytics and AI-driven insights for control testing and risk assessment.,Stays updated with technological advancements and proactively acquires new skills.
